Hi Slight change would make an easy connection, fly into Reno a bus from our area runs 4 days a week from the Reno Airport to Lone Pine. Check easternsierratransit.com leaves Reno 1:50 PM arrives Lone Pine 7 :40 pm Mon, Tues, Thurs Fri. Thanks Doug

A few years ago I did Lone Pine to Las Vegas one way on same day, so you can do this in reverse order ( but not every day of the week)

Lone Pine to Inyokern/Ridgcrest/China Lake NAS on ESTA/CREST bus

rent car one way Ridgecrest to Las Vegas.

When I did it a few years ago, the bus stopped right next to the rental car place in Ridgecrest. this may be different now. Call them and ask. Website not enough info.
